Citations
2 citations on file for this inspection.
1926.102 A01
- Issued
- Dec 6, 2023
- Penalty
- Initial $3,349 · Current $3,349
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.102(a)(1): Employees were not provided with eye and face protection equipment when machines or operations present potential eye or face injury from physical, chemical, or radiation agents: On or about 10/31/2023, the employer did not protect employees who were exposed to struck-by hazards due to using pneumatic nail guns without the use of eye protection at a residential roofing job site located at 208 Charging Bear Dr., Wentzville, MO.

1926.501 B13
- Issued
- Dec 6, 2023
- Penalty
- Initial $4,688 · Current $4,688
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13):Each employee(s) eng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b): On or about 10/31/2023, the employer did not protect employees who were engaged in residential roofing operations 6ft (1.8m) or more above lower levels while at the job site located at 208 Charging Bear Dr., Wentzville, MO. The employees were conducting residential roofing operations and were exposed to the hazard of falling approximately ten (10) feet.
